Average salary of an electrician in the UK

The salary of an electrician can differ depending on the location they work in and their the status of their employment. The majority of customers will pay more for an experienced electrician who is competent. Highly skilled electricians can charge as much as PS45 an hour for work that is complex. This job is highly paid in the UK.

Electricians are responsible to install repairs, maintain, and repair electrical equipment, machinery wires, and other related devices. Electricity is a fundamental part of nearly every business, home and industrial space. An electrician works to ensure that these appliances operate properly and safely. Whether they are working in an office, factory, or in the home, electricians are expected to provide excellent customer service.

According to the 2020 UK trades survey, electricians are among the most lucrative trades. While this might appear to be untrue, the most highly-paid electricians are self-employed. Additionally, they can earn much more than those with only a high-school degree. With the right skills, electricians can expect to earn upwards of P32,000 a year.

The salary of an electrician can be affected by a variety factors, including the level of experience. The average pay for a typical electrician is PS32,805, but it can increase when an electrician gains experience. An electrician could also expect to earn up to PS70,000 depending on the type of work they do.

The average UK electrician's wage varies on what type of work they perform and where they work. Some electricians charge an hourly rate and others pay per day. In the South East, electricians earn approximately PS45-70 an hour, whereas electricians in London make around PS180-350 per day.

Average salary for a self-employed electrician in UK

Self-employment is a great method to get a higher income, but it requires lots of work. It's not easy to determine how much you can earn, so it's important to plan your work schedule in line with. An electrician who works for a long time will likely have their earnings fluctuate. If you're looking to earn a more stable income, you might want to look into working for an agency, which allows you to gain experience when applying for contracts. Overtime is also a good way to earn extra money and is usually paid at a higher rate. You can choose your own projects and decide on your rates.

The average earnings of self-employed electricians in the UK is PS1,074 each week. This is roughly 52,000 dollars annually. According to Hudson Contract, the largest subcontractor for construction electricians who work for themselves earned 5.6% less in October than previous years. In the Yorkshire and Humber region as well as the East Midlands region saw the highest growth in self-employment income.

Getting more experience will increase your earning potential. An electrician with more of experience and qualifications will be able to offer more reliable services to clients and undertake more challenging assignments. Experienced electricians might charge more for more complicated tasks and other services. This is a great way to increase the amount you earn and also your standing.

The electrical industry is facing an acute shortage of skilled personnel. With an insufficient number of electricians companies are having difficulty meeting the demand. However, there are numerous new apprenticeships that are being developed in the field. Despite these obstacles, there are many opportunities for self-employment in the electrical industry.

You will be the one to set your own rates as an electrician self-employed. Most self-employed electricians charge between PS20 and PS50 per hour. Some electricians charge a per-day rate that is less expensive than an hourly rate. Day rates can vary from PS200 to PS350 in some regions.

Cost of hiring an electrician in the UK

The cost of hiring an electrician UK is contingent on their experience and skill. The typical hourly rate is around PS40 and up, with London and the south east being more expensive. Some electricians work on a daily rate, which means they will charge PS250 per day. Travel time is added to the hourly rate.

Additionally, different kinds of jobs require different types of electricians. For example, if you are planning to have a complete rewire carried out, you will need an electrician who has the right qualifications. Also, if you're planning to have outdoor lighting, you'll need an electrician who has the right experience. It's a good idea to get quotes from a variety of companies to find the most competitive price.

Another factor to consider when hiring an electrician is location. An electrician uk who lives in remote regions or in rural areas is likely to be more expensive than one who lives in the city. Additionally, electricians will likely be required to pay for travel time and gas to reach your property. This can increase the total cost of hiring an electrician. The typical electrician's job can take anywhere between one and eight hours.

Another way to cut down on the cost of hiring an electrician is to prepare your house beforehand. Before the electrician arrives, you must take out any wiring that is not needed and ensure it is disconnected. Otherwise, it might become a risk to your safety. In addition you could make the process simpler by moving furniture out of the way so that the electrician can effectively.

The cost of hiring an electrician in the UK will vary depending on the requirements of your home and location. The cost of a rewire depends on how big your house is and the amount of work to be done. Rewiring a large house will take longer than a typical one. If you reside in a city area or a large city, you'll have to pay more.
